Archive plan after completion
Hi All, What is the best parctice after the plan is completed under Planner and what will happend to the office 365 group created with it. also Can I add plan to exsiting Office 365 group? ...
- Feb 18, 2017We cannot currently archive a plan since this feature is not available in the product. You can create a Plan from a existing Group, so the answer to your second question is "Yes"
